Market Strategy and Business Structure
America’s Car-Mart maintains a distinctive model in the automotive retail sector. Based in Arkansas, the firm concentrates on pre-owned vehicles with an emphasis on serving credit-limited customer segments. Financing options are provided in-house, supporting continued transaction volume.
This vertically integrated approach helps retain control over payment terms and vehicle sourcing. By focusing on older vehicle models and flexible payment structures, the company sustains a presence in markets less dominated by traditional auto retailers.
